如何在CMD中开启数据库?

在命令提示符(cmd)下开启数据库,首先确保已安装相应数据库软件。以MySQL为例,打开cmd后输入mysql -u 用户名 -p,然后输入密码即可进入数据库。

在Windows操作系统中,使用命令提示符(CMD)打开并管理数据库是一种常见且高效的方法,下面将详细讲解如何通过CMD命令进入MySQL、PostgreSQL和SQL Server三种常见的数据库系统,并提供相关示例操作。

如何在CMD中开启数据库?

一、打开命令提示符

1、启动命令提示符:在Windows系统中,点击“开始”菜单,搜索“cmd”或“命令提示符”,然后点击打开,对于Mac和Linux用户,可以直接打开终端。

2、确保数据库服务已启动:在连接到数据库之前,请确保数据库服务正在运行,对于MySQL,可以通过以下命令检查服务状态:

   net start | findstr MySQL

如果服务未启动,可以使用以下命令启动:

   net start MySQL

二、使用数据库特定的命令

1、MySQL数据库:要进入MySQL数据库,使用以下命令:

   mysql -u [username] -p

-u [username] : 指定数据库用户名。

-p : 提示用户输入密码。

   mysql -u root -p

输入密码后,您将进入MySQL命令行界面。

2、PostgreSQL数据库:进入PostgreSQL数据库,使用以下命令:

   psql -U [username] -d [database]

-U [username] : 指定数据库用户名。

-d [database] : 指定数据库名称。

如何在CMD中开启数据库?

   psql -U postgres -d mydatabase

3、SQL Server数据库:进入SQL Server数据库,使用以下命令:

   sqlcmd -S [server] -U [username] -P [password]

-S [server] : 指定服务器名称。

-U [username] : 指定数据库用户名。

-P [password] : 指定数据库密码。

   sqlcmd -S localhost -U sa -P mypassword

三、提供正确的登录凭证

1、用户名和密码:输入用户名和密码是进入数据库的必要步骤,对于MySQL数据库,命令行将提示您输入密码;而对于SQL Server,您可以直接在命令中输入密码。

2、数据库名称:某些数据库系统(如PostgreSQL)需要指定数据库名称,这样可以直接进入指定的数据库,而无需在进入数据库系统后再选择数据库。

3、连接选项:有些数据库支持更多的连接选项,例如指定端口、SSL连接等,可以根据需要进行配置,对于MySQL,可以使用以下命令指定端口:

   mysql -u root -p --port=3306

四、实际操作示例

1、MySQL数据库:假设您需要连接到名为“testdb”的MySQL数据库,用户名为“admin”,命令如下:

   mysql -u admin -p testdb

2、PostgreSQL数据库:假设您需要连接到名为“testdb”的PostgreSQL数据库,用户名为“admin”,命令如下:

如何在CMD中开启数据库?

   psql -U admin -d testdb

3、SQL Server数据库:假设您需要连接到名为“testdb”的SQL Server数据库,服务器为“localhost”,用户名为“admin”,密码为“password”,命令如下:

   sqlcmd -S localhost -U admin -P password -d testdb

五、常见问题与解决方法

1、连接超时:如果出现连接超时错误,可能是数据库服务未启动或网络连接问题,确保数据库服务已启动,并检查网络连接。

2、权限不足:如果出现权限不足错误,确保使用具有足够权限的用户进行连接,并检查用户权限设置。

3、无法找到命令:如果命令提示符无法找到数据库命令,可能是环境变量未设置,确保将数据库的可执行文件路径添加到系统环境变量中。

六、最佳实践与注意事项

1、使用环境变量:为了简化命令行操作,可以将数据库连接信息(如用户名、密码、服务器地址等)存储在环境变量中。

2、安全性:不要在命令行中直接输入密码,以防密码泄露,可以使用配置文件或环境变量存储密码。

3、日志记录:记录连接操作的日志,以便在出现问题时进行排查。

通过以上步骤和注意事项,您可以在命令提示符中高效地进入和管理数据库,确保项目顺利进行,希望本文的内容对你有所帮助。

小伙伴们,上文介绍了“cmd开启数据库”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。

文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/55164.html<

(0)
运维的头像运维
上一篇2025-01-15 09:29
下一篇 2025-01-15 09:33

相关推荐

  • 搜房网招聘PHP,具体要求有哪些?

    搜房网作为中国领先的房地产互联网平台,始终致力于通过技术创新和服务升级为用户提供全面的房产信息与服务,随着业务的不断拓展和技术迭代,搜房网在PHP开发领域持续吸纳优秀人才,以构建更高效、稳定的系统架构,支撑平台在海量数据处理、高并发访问及业务功能创新等方面的需求,以下从岗位方向、核心要求、职业发展及应聘建议等方……

    2025-10-22
    0
  • PHP系统招聘,具体要求有哪些?

    在现代企业信息化建设中,PHP作为一门成熟的开源脚本语言,凭借其跨平台性、易用性和丰富的生态资源,在Web系统开发领域占据重要地位,随着企业数字化转型的深入,针对PHP系统的招聘需求持续增长,涵盖从初级开发工程师到架构师的全岗位体系,同时对候选人的技术能力、项目经验和综合素质提出了更高要求,本文将从PHP系统招……

    2025-10-19
    0
  • PHP包头招聘有哪些岗位要求?

    php包头招聘近年来呈现出活跃态势,随着互联网技术的快速发展和企业数字化转型的深入推进,包头地区对PHP开发人才的需求持续增长,涵盖互联网企业、软件开发公司、传统行业IT部门等多个领域,从岗位类型来看,PHP包头招聘主要集中在初级PHP开发工程师、中级PHP开发工程师、高级PHP开发工程师、全栈开发工程师(PH……

    2025-10-17
    0
  • 江西PHP招聘有哪些具体岗位和要求?

    随着江西省数字经济的快速发展和产业升级的深入推进,PHP开发人才在省内IT行业的需求持续攀升,尤其在南昌、赣州、九江等地的互联网企业、软件开发公司及传统企业数字化转型部门中,PHP岗位招聘热度居高不下,以下从PHP岗位需求、技能要求、薪资水平及求职建议等方面进行详细分析,为求职者提供参考,PHP岗位需求现状江西……

    2025-10-16
    0
  • PHP柳州招聘有哪些岗位要求?

    php柳州招聘:近年来,随着互联网技术的快速发展和数字化转型的深入推进,PHP作为一门成熟且应用广泛的编程语言,在柳州地区的就业市场中持续保持着稳定的需求,柳州作为广西重要的工业城市和区域中心城市,近年来在智能制造、电子商务、软件开发等领域的发展带动了对IT技术人才的迫切需求,其中PHP开发工程师因其岗位适配性……

    2025-09-21
    0

发表回复

您的邮箱地址不会被公开。必填项已用 * 标注